    • 663 2 Higher petrol prices PETROL prices will rise next year when oil companies make the final reduction in petrol's lead content to achieve the regulation level of 0.4 g per litre. They have been absorbing the costs of this anti-pollution measure since July 1960. But the latest effort will cost

    • 272 2 BANKS IN SCRAMBLE TO INSTALL TELLER MACHINES THE rapid growth of automated teller machines here is expected to continue into the next year, with the number projected to exceed 400 by the end of 1983. This will be double the present number. The growth is largely the result

    • 579 2 Red ties under strain SOVIET UNION'S efforts to mend relations with China appear to be causing strains in its close ties with Vietnam, according to Asian and communist diplomats in Moscow. The Vietnamese are worried a deal will be struck at their expense. Asian diplomats believe the

The US armed services are recruiting enough well-qualified volunteers and there is no need to, bring back the military draft abolished in 1973, a military manpower task force told President Ronald Reagan yesterday. Defence Secretary Caspar Weinberger said after conferring

The United States and Canada are close to an agreement that would permit air force B-52 bombers to launch cruise missiles into a Canadian target zone. The missiles are for testing over terrain similar to that of the Soviet Union, Defence Department

  • 112 9 CAPITAL INFLOW REMAINS HIGH SINGAPORE has been able to continue attracting foreign investment despite the world economic recession. For the first eight months of this year, total commitments exceeded $1.3 billion and if the momentum remains, it will exceed last year's figure of $1.94 billion This was a convincing demonstration

Japan's Fair Trade Commission has approved the formation of a production cartel among 12 major ethylene producers for the first time since 1972. The cartel will run for five-and-a-half months,, 1 until the end of March next year, and will allow

The big French oil companies, faced with heavy losses caused by the strong United States dollar ana the government's petrol price controls, are running up record overdrafts with the main Paris banks. This is one of the chief factors putting
